I just installed B cam, GT40 heads and a 95 cobra intake on my 95 gt (AODE). I have the base timing set at 12 degrees and i cant find vacuum leaks, smog and Egr are deleted. the car revs fine and pulls strong, but it dies at idle, I adjusted the screw on my throttle body to get it to idle higher and this made it stay on but when i put it in drive it dies, also It seems like its idling better in the cold once the engine heats up it dies easier. what direction should i look into first, how do you adjust idle on a sn95?

jrichker is on target. I had idle problems with my crammed 4.6, even after tuning. It acted like a bad IAC, but deteriorated after replacing it a second time. Turned out to be a bad computer idle circuit. That would be the last thing I'd look at, as the steps in the linkjrichker supplied are much more likely. However, if after a tune and following all other reasonable steps, that might be something to look at
